Chocolate & PB Dessert (Print Version)

# Ingredients:

→ Base Layer

01 - 1 (18-ounce) package of chilled chocolate chip cookie dough

→ Extras

02 - 3/4 cup smooth peanut butter
03 - 1/2 cup mini peanut butter chocolate candies
04 - 1 cup chocolate chips (semi-sweet)
05 - 1/4 cup peanuts, salted and chopped
06 - 1/4 cup tiny candy-coated chocolates
07 - Optional: chocolate syrup for drizzling

# Instructions:

01 - Set your oven to 350°F. Lightly oil a 12-inch pizza tray.
02 - Spread out the dough evenly, covering the tray all the way to the edges.
03 - Bake for 22-28 minutes or until you see a light golden color. Let it cool for 10 to 12 minutes max.
04 - Start by spreading the peanut butter evenly across. Sprinkle the chocolate chips, peanut butter cups, candy-coated chocolates, and chopped peanuts on top. For extra sweetness, drizzle chocolate syrup if you’d like.
05 - Slice it up like a pizza and serve while it’s still warm.
